Abstract:
New high-performance construction materials are being
developed for transportation structures. Economic
methods are needed for assessing the life-cycle cost
advantages and disadvantages of these new materials
relative to conventional meterials. This paper provides
a step-by-step, project-based approach based on life
cycle costing, minimum performance requirements, and a
cost classification scheme that organizes a construction
material's life cycle cost advantages and disadvantages.
A case study example of the method analyzes the cost
effectiveness of fiber-reinforced-polymer bridge decks
relative to reinforced concrete decks.
